The Cronulla Sharks look to bounce back from a heavy defeat to the ladder leaders as they welcome the North Queensland Cowboys to their temporary home. Join The Roar for live scores from 5:30pm (AEST).

The Sharks come into this one off a second belting for the year at the hands of Penrith, losing 38-12 at the foot of the mountains. That loss means Cronulla have not beaten a top-eight side all year. Five attempts, five losses. It hardly needs to be said that this is not an ideal stat for any team heading into the finals.

The Cowboys took a big step backwards after an improved showing two weeks ago in a one-point loss to the Rabbitohs. They followed that up by laying an egg in Newcastle, and despite getting some key pieces back from injury recently, they have now lost their talisman Jason Taumalolo.

The North Queenslanders are playing for pride now, which could be an ominous sign after interim coach Josh Hannay recently questioned their commitment to the jersey.

This doesn’t bode well facing a team stinging from a loss. Despite Cronulla’s woeful record against the top teams, they have feasted on the likes of the Cowboys. The last time Penrith spanked the Sharks, John Morris’s men responded the following week and put 46 past the Titans.

This has all the makings of a blowout too if the Cowboys aren’t careful.
